Overview
Cemented Carbide WC-Co K10
ISO K10 cemented tungsten carbide with ~6% cobalt binder. The hardest standard WC-Co grade (92–93 HRA, ~1600 HV) with highest wear resistance but lowest toughness. Density ~14.9 g/cm³, TRS 1800–2200 MPa, elastic modulus ~620 GPa. Fine to submicron grain. Applications: finish turning and boring of cast iron, non-ferrous metals, hardened steel; PCB drilling; wire drawing dies; seal rings; wear parts with no impact. ANSI C2/C3, China YG6.
Cemented Carbide WC-TiC-Co P20
ISO P20 cemented carbide with WC + TiC/TaC + Co. Designed for machining steel and steel castings. TiC addition provides crater wear resistance essential for steel cutting. Hardness 91–92 HRA, density ~12.0–13.0 g/cm³ (lower than K-grades due to TiC), TRS 1800–2200 MPa. Applications: general turning, milling, planing of carbon steel, alloy steel, tool steel, ferritic and martensitic stainless steel. ANSI C6, China YT15.

Chemical composition (wt%)
| Element | Cemented Carbide WC-Co K10 | Cemented Carbide WC-TiC-Co P20 | Overlap |
|---|---|---|---|
| WC | 93–95% | 70–80% | No overlap |
| Co | 5.5–6.5% | 8–10% | No overlap |
| TaC | ≤ 0.5% | 2–8% | No overlap |
| TiC | — | 8–15% | — |
Mechanical properties
| Property | Cemented Carbide WC-Co K10 | Cemented Carbide WC-TiC-Co P20 | Unit |
|---|---|---|---|
| density | 14.8–15 | 12–13 | g/cm3 |
| hardness_hra | 92–93 | 91–92 | HRA |
| hardness_vickers | 1550–1650 | 1450–1550 | HV30 |
